ISO 105-C07 Color Fastness to Washing with Soap and Detergents: A Comprehensive Guide

Introduction

The ISO 105-C07 standard is a widely recognized and respected benchmark for evaluating the colorfastness of textiles to washing with soap and detergents. This comprehensive guide provides an in-depth exploration of the testing requirements, methodologies, and benefits associated with this laboratory test.

Relevant Standards and Frameworks

The ISO 105-C07 standard is a globally recognized benchmark for evaluating the colorfastness of textiles to washing with soap and detergents. This standard is part of the ISO 105 series, which provides guidelines for assessing the colorfastness of textiles under various conditions.
